What events lead to the eventual entrance of America into the war?

1)British and German Blockades meant our cargo was being seized 2)Right to search and seize ships w/ "war goods" 3)Bombing of the Lusitania 4)Sussex Pledge and its negation 5) Black Tom Island Ammo dump explosion 6)Zimmerman Telegram

What were the major problems of the 1920's?

1)Overproduction with oversaturation and no planned obsolescence. 2)Inflation - Florida land boom example of pyramid scheme 3)Stock market "Orgy" - no rewgulation, insider trading, stock overvalued 4) Black Friday

What points did Wilson propose?

Self determination of nations, Not so successful in middle east. International code of conduct: free trade, reduce arms, ban poison gasses, League of Nations to arbitrate disputes (but no enforcement powers)
